#369759 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#369759 is composed of 21.2% red, 59.2%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 41.1% yellow and 40.8% black. It has a hue angle of 141.6 degrees, a saturation of 47.3% and a lightness of 40.2%. #369759 color hex could be obtained by blending #6cffb2 with #002f00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#369759 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#369759 has RGB values of R:54, G:151, B:89 and CMYK values of C:0.64, M:0, Y:0.41, K:0.41. Its decimal value is 3577689.

Shades and Tints of #369759
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020704 is the darkest color, while #f7fc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#369759
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#656866 is the less saturated color, while #07c64c is the most saturated one.
